The Ultimate Buying Guide for Your Deer Hunting Ground Blind
Choosing the right ground blind makes a big difference in your deer hunting success. A good blind keeps you hidden and comfortable. This guide will help you pick the best one for your needs. We cover what to look for and answer common questions.
Key Features to Look For
When you shop for a ground blind, several features really matter. Think about these things before you buy.
Size and Capacity
- Room to Move: Make sure the blind is big enough for you. If you hunt with a partner or need space for gear, choose a larger model. Small blinds make you feel cramped.
- Height: Taller blinds let you stand up comfortably. Shorter blinds are less visible but might limit movement.
Window System
- Visibility: You need clear views in all directions. Look for blinds with multiple large windows.
- Silent Operation: Windows must open and close quietly. Zippers that stick or flaps that rustle loudly will scare deer away. Silent magnetic or hook-and-loop closures are best.
Portability and Setup
- Weight and Bag: A heavy blind is hard to carry long distances. Check the weight and how easily it packs into its carrying bag.
- Ease of Setup: Some blinds use a simple pop-up frame. These set up in seconds. Others require more time assembling poles. Quick setup is great when deer are moving fast.
Important Materials and Durability
The material of your blind affects how long it lasts and how well it hides you.
Fabric Quality
- Denier Rating: This number tells you how tough the fabric is. Higher denier (like 300D or more) means thicker, stronger material. This resists tears from branches.
- Waterproofing: Good blinds have a water-resistant coating. This keeps you dry during light rain.
Camouflage Pattern
- Matching Your Area: Choose a pattern that matches your hunting environment (woods, field edges). Good camo blends the blind into the background.
Frame Strength
- Sturdy Poles: The frame poles should be strong but flexible. They need to hold the shape even in wind. Cheap frames bend or break easily.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Quality is often found in the details. Small things can make a big difference in your hunt.
Quality Boosters
- Shooting Rails: These internal shelves let you rest your gun or bow quietly while aiming. They greatly improve shooting accuracy.
- Scent Control: Some advanced fabrics help absorb or mask human scent. This is a huge advantage when hunting wary animals.
- Extra Tie-Downs: Strong loops and stakes help secure the blind against strong winds.
Quality Reducers
- Shiny Fabric: If the inside material reflects light, deer will spot it. Dark, non-reflective interiors are essential.
- Poor Stitching: Look closely at the seams. Loose or weak stitching means the blind will tear quickly.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about *how* you plan to use your ground blind.
Hunting Scenarios
- Long-Term Setup: If you leave the blind set up for several days, you need highly durable, weather-proof material.
- Mobile Hunting: If you move to a new spot every day, prioritize lightweight design and the fastest setup time possible.
Comfort Factors
A comfortable hunter stays focused longer. Check if the blind allows enough airflow. Stuffiness makes long sits miserable. Also, ensure there is enough room for a good hunting chair.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Ground Blinds
Q: How do I make my ground blind invisible to deer?
A: You must use natural cover. Place the blind near bushes or trees. Always brush in the blind by adding local leaves and branches to the outside loops.
Q: Should I buy a hub-style or pole-style blind?
A: Hub-style blinds connect at central points and pop open easily. Pole-style blinds use separate poles. Hub-style is generally faster and easier for most users.
Q: What is the best height for a ground blind?
A: A blind around 6 to 7 feet tall works well for most standing hunters. Measure the height needed for your specific bow draw or rifle position.
Q: Will my scent leak out of the windows?
A: Yes, scent can leak. Keep windows closed until the deer are close. Use scent-control sprays on your gear inside the blind.
Q: How important is a silent zipper?
A: It is very important. Deer have excellent hearing. If a zipper squeaks when you open it for a shot, the deer will hear it.
Q: Can I shoot a crossbow from any ground blind?
A: Most modern blinds work for crossbows. Check that the shooting windows are wide enough for your bolt to clear the frame without hitting anything.
Q: How do I stop the ground blind from blowing over?
A: Use all the included tie-downs and stakes. If the ground is hard, use heavy bags filled with sand or rocks placed inside the blind corners for extra weight.
Q: Are camouflage patterns different for early season versus late season?
A: Yes. Early season needs patterns that match green leaves. Late season needs patterns that match bare branches and brown grasses.
Q: How long should a quality blind last?
A: A well-made blind used only a few times a year should last 3 to 5 seasons. Heavy use may shorten this time.
Q: Do I need a blind chair?
A: Yes. Sitting directly on the ground gets cold and uncomfortable fast. A small, low-profile chair improves your comfort and shooting stability significantly.
